Principal Software Engineers
Job Responsibilities:
The Principal Software Engineer will work as part of the perception software team and with related software and hardware teams to develop new functionalities and extend existing functionalities of material handling robotic systems. Responsibilities will include:
- Conduct full-cycle development of perception functions, autonomously or under the supervision of a team leader.
- Write unit tests and test functions on real hardware as required.
- Read and understand existing code and provide code reviews for peers.
- Make reasonable estimates of task execution times and adhere to them.
- Search for, read, and implement algorithms from engineering books and research papers.
- Collect, process, and annotate datasets.
- Train, fine-tune, and validate machine learning models.
- Continuously self-educate on the latest developments in perception and robotics.
Telecommuting is not available.
Travel Requirement: 10% Domestic travel required per year.
Education, Experience and Skills Requirements:
The employer requires at least a master's degree in computer science, robotics, mechanical engineering, or a closely related field, and at least 2 years of work experience in software development with a focus on computer vision and robotics. In addition, the employer requires:
(1) Demonstrated ability to design and develop complex robotic software systems using Python and C++, including the integration of perception, planning, and control components, gained through at least two (2) years of work experience.
(2) Demonstrated ability to architect and optimize machine learning pipelines, including model training, evaluation, and deployment in production environments to meet operational KPIs gained through at least two (2) years of work experience.
(3) Demonstrated proficiency with perception and 3D processing libraries including OpenCV, PCL, and Open3D and applying them to large-scale or real-time robotic systems gained through at least two (2) years of work experience.
(4) Demonstrated ability to lead technical investigations and evaluate algorithmic tradeoffs for perception tasks such as grasp point generation, object detection, point cloud processing, anomaly detection, or automatic sensor calibration gained through at least two (2) years of work experience.
(5) Demonstrated experience working with diverse machine vision sensors including RGB cameras, grayscale 2D cameras, and 3D sensors and applying sensor data in multi-sensor fusion or calibration pipelines gained through at least two (2) years of work experience.
(6) Demonstrated ability to guide technical prioritization, coordinate cross-functional deliverables, and drive consensus on design decisions to support large-scale robotic deployments gained through at least one (1) year of work experience.
All years of experience may be gained concurrently. Experience gained in connection with post-bachelor’s degree program or with internships acceptable.
This position is eligible for Berkshire Grey, Inc.’s Employee Referral Program.
Applicants can send resumes to Berkshire Grey, Inc, 140 South Road, Bedford, MA 01730 (Attn: Req# HR2026-03) or apply online at
HR2026-03
Recommended Jobs
2026 SkillBridge Candidates/HOH Fellows
Responsibilities for this Position 2026 SkillBridge Candidates/HOH Fellows ID: 2026-71047 Required Clearance: No clearance Posted Date: 2/20/2026 Category: Various Employment Type:…
Project Coordinator (OBAT TTA)
POSITION SUMMARY : The Office Based Addiction Treatment (OBAT) team in the Section of General Internal Medicine at Boston Medical Center seeks a highly motivated individual to provide administr…
Clinical Trial Medical Technologist I
Overview The Clinical Research Laboratory (CRL) Medical Technologist is responsible for processing all clinical samples from patients on clinical trials at the institute. The technologist needs …
Area Reset Merchandiser
About the Role We are looking for temporary to part-time, independent Retail Merchandisers to support projects on behalf of retailers and consumer brands. This role involves completing a variety…
Medical NP/PA (FT/PT)
Job Description Job Description Description: About Us: For over 32 years, CPS Healthcare has been more than a healthcare provider—we’ve been a trusted partner to the communities and correc…
Personal Care Assistant for senior citizens. Rockport, MA
Job Description Job Description PCA- Personal Care Assistant/ Companion Flexible Hours Available/ Create your own schedule. WE ARE HIRING IN THE FOLLOWING AREAS: Rockport, Essex, Ipswich…
Project Manager
Goody Clancy Employer Boston, MA, USLocation: Thu, Mar 12 '26Posted On $95,000 - $120,000 annually Pay: Firm Overview Goody Clancy seeks a Project Manager to join our collaborative and …
Entry Level Accountant
Entry Level Accountant Certified Public Accountants | Business Consultants We are seeking a highly motivated staff accountant with an undergraduate degree in accounting to join our firm and share in…
Street Team
Title: Street Team Type: Part Time Location: Waltham, MA Beasley Media Group stations 98.5 THE SPORTS HUB, COUNTRY 102.5, WROR 105.7 and HOT 96.9 is seeking part-time Street Team members w…
Pouch Making Lead Operator
Job Description Job Description Position summary: Working shift lead for pouch-making equipment. You will be expected to give directions and monitor pouch-making operators. You will need to ma…